Output 6b2ba84f82f4dc66ffb3b331ebc1244d577c73e6af858c065a49f8a380467f2d:20

value
31582482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b7562cca5cead8d3e6498c904a5f48df145fa3 OP_EQUAL
address
MBybbKf3RzYXsAaqLyudt1Mn38ARas9Zes
transaction
6b2ba84f82f4dc66ffb3b331ebc1244d577c73e6af858c065a49f8a380467f2d
spent
true